Heating wallboard electric connection assembly
Technical Field
The utility model relates to the technical field of heating wallboards, in particular to an electric connection assembly of a heating wallboard.
Background
Under the state clean heating tide, the traditional electric heating has dry pavement and wet pavement, the installation is relatively complex, and the original ground is needed to be dug out particularly in old house reconstruction;
when traditional graphene electric heating and carbon crystal electric heating are paved on a wall surface, the connection is made of common structural adhesive according to the conventional method, the construction period is long, and the labor cost is high.

Referring to fig. 1 to 3, the present utility model provides a technical solution: a heat generating wallboard electrical connection assembly comprising: the heating wall plate 1, the surface of the heating wall plate 1 is provided with a male head 7;
the hanging piece of the fixed groove is characterized in that a plug hole 3 is formed in the surface of the hanging piece of the fixed groove 2, a first sliding groove 5 is formed in the surface of the hanging piece of the fixed groove, a second sliding groove 8 is formed in the surface of the hanging piece of the fixed groove, the plug hole 3 is connected with the first sliding groove 5, a female head 6 is arranged in the plug hole 3 and the first sliding groove 5, the female head 6 can move back and forth in the plug hole 3 and the first sliding groove 5, a wire 4 is arranged at the top of the female head 6, the wire 4 is connected with a power supply, the female head 6 can be plugged in a male head 7, an annular groove is formed in the surface of the male head 7, the cross section of the end part of the male head 7 is circular, the diameter of the cross section of the male head 7 is consistent with the diameter of the plug hole 3, the width of the first sliding groove 5 is smaller than the diameter of the male head 7, and when the male head 7 moves in the first sliding groove 5, two ends of the first sliding groove 5 are clamped in the annular groove on the surface of the male head 7;
the sliding rod 11 is inserted into the second sliding groove 8, the sliding rod 11 can move back and forth in the second sliding groove 8, a rubber block 10 is arranged at the end part of the sliding rod 11, a fixing groove 9 is formed in the surface of the fixing groove pendant 2, and the rubber block 10 can be clamped in the fixing groove 9 along with the movement of the sliding rod 11.
The fixed slot pendant 2 is fixed on the wall, then move the position of spliced eye 3 with slide bar 11, peg graft female head 6 in public head 7 with public head 7 and female head 6 are fixed together, public head 7 is fixed on the surface of heating wallboard 1, remove heating wallboard 1 for slide bar 11 moves along second spout 8, and public head 7 surface gets the groove card in first spout 5, fix public head 7 in first spout 5 after the removal, just fix the surface at the wall with heating wallboard 1, and slide bar 11 removes the back, rubber piece 10 card is in fixed slot 9, prevent that slide bar 11 from removing in second spout 8.
